Why is Art Deco considered a luxurious fashion style?
Art Deco is considered a luxurious fashion style due to its use of high-quality materials such as silk, satin, and velvet, along with extravagant embellishments like beads, sequins, and embroidery. The style's focus on elegance, opulence, and sophisticated design elements further contributes to its association with luxury. This emphasis on glamour and refinement helped cement Art Deco as an enduring symbol of lavish fashion.
